Section 814(c) of the Violence Against
Women and Department of Justice Reauthorization Act of 2005 (VAWA
2005) amended the Immigration and Nationality Act (INA) to provide
eligibility for employment authorization to certain abused spouses
of nonimmigrants admitted under INA section 101(a)(15)(A),
(E)(iii), (G), or (H). This provision is codified in INA section
106. U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) will use
Form I-765V, Application for Employment Authorization for Abused
Nonimmigrant Spouse, to collect the information that is necessary
to determine if the applicant is eligible for an initial EAD or
renewal EAD as a qualifying abused nonimmigrant spouse.
